Jean Franco is a scholar working on Literature and Literary Theory, Cultural Studies and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Jean Franco has authored 88 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Literature and Literary Theory, 20 papers in Cultural Studies and 9 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Jean Franco’s work include Latin American Literature Studies (17 papers), Comparative Literary Analysis and Criticism (11 papers) and Cultural and Social Studies in Latin America (7 papers). Jean Franco is often cited by papers focused on Latin American Literature Studies (17 papers), Comparative Literary Analysis and Criticism (11 papers) and Cultural and Social Studies in Latin America (7 papers). Jean Franco coll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Argentina. Jean Franco's co-authors include Gayatri Chakravorty Spivak, Rubén Ardila, Silvia Marina Arrom, John S. Brushwood, George R. McMurray, Beatriz Sarlo, Michael J. Lazzara, Carlos A. Pujol, George Yúdice and Rita Felski and has published in prestigious journals such as Signs, Hispanic American Historical Review and Feminist Review.
